Summary

This BIT proposes the veAlpha governance layer for Bittensor — a vote-escrowed subnet governance system with liquidation auctions.

  • veAlpha voting power is derived from locking a subnet's Alpha token for up to 4 years, with linear decay — tying governance influence directly to long-term economic commitment.
  • Liquidation challenges allow the community to democratically challenge misaligned subnets through bonded proposals and veAlpha-weighted votes. Successful challenges trigger a Dutch auction for the subnet slot, preserving value through orderly transfer rather than destruction.
  • Hyperparameter governance extends the same bonded-proposal framework to let committed stakeholders propose on-chain configuration changes.
  • Root staker participation gives TAO stakers an 18% network-level voice in subnet governance via a gauge-style allocation mechanism.

Motivation

Bittensor currently lacks a formal governance layer for subnet oversight. Subnet owners receive 18% of emissions, control hyperparameters, and occupy scarce network slots — but face no structured accountability. Recent incidents (Covenant AI mass-liquidation, Subnet 29 governance failures) illustrate the risks. The only existing removal mechanism is price-based deregistration, which creates strong incumbency bias.

This proposal introduces a market-driven, time-weighted governance layer that enables the network to democratically prune or transition subnets without requiring price decay.

Key Sections

  • Specification: veAlpha locking mechanics, root staker participation, liquidation challenges, subnet owner defense, Dutch auction, auction resolution, hyperparameter governance, incentive dynamics
  • Security Considerations: Bond griefing, whale dominance, lock manipulation, gauge-weight manipulation, auction gaming, cold key swap security
  • Implementation Paths: Native Subtensor pallet (runtime upgrade) or SubtensorEVM smart contracts
